Iran, Israel ‘should not escalate this conflict’: Blinken

ANNAPOLIS, United States: Both Iran and Israel should avoid escalating conflict in the Middle East, US Secretary of State Antony Blinken said Tuesday, in his most direct wording toward US ally Israel.
“No one should escalate this conflict. We’ve been engaged in intense diplomacy with allies and partners, communicating that message directly to Iran. We communicated that message directly to Israel,” Blinken told reporters.
Iran has vowed a response after Israel killed Hamas political leader Ismail Haniyeh in Tehran.
